Historic building
The is a log, one-room jail previously used in . It was built in 1853 and was used until 1870. In 1986, it was listed on the National Register of Historic Places, and is preserved by the Washington County Museum in , and is exhibited outside of the museum near its entrance. is situated 1½ miles northwest of Tokola Wetlands Park.
